Log Cabin Front Porch is an art print I created using an impasto oil technique. This technique focuses on bold brush strokes and bright colors creating a traditional oil painting look. The inspiration behind this art print is the original governors mansion built in Prescott Arizona. The structure was built in 1864 to house the governor of the newly aligned Arizona Territory. It currently sits on the grounds of the Sharlot Hall Museum.
